How they compare
Aruba currently reports 50.38 % change on previous year against 15.13 % change on previous year in Africa Eastern and Southern, a difference of 35.25 % change on previous year.
That makes Aruba's figure about 3.3 times Africa Eastern and Southern's.
The two have swapped places 11 times across 29 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Africa Eastern and Southern ahead.
Africa Eastern and Southern ranks 9th and Aruba ranks 9th of 41 groups.
Across the 4 decades both report, Africa Eastern and Southern averaged higher in 1 and Aruba in 3.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Gross domestic savings (current US$).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
